They are a sort of surfactant, which is "the framework" of the shampoo, claimed Anthony Ryan OBE, professor of physical chemistry at the University of Sheffield and co-author of a recent study discovering the topic. sulfate free shampoo. Is hair shampoo a thing of the past? Current clinical consensus states, no. The study released in Macromolecular Chemistry and Physics examines the parts of hair shampoo with the utmost goal of making it as kind to the skin and to the environment as feasible.


The tail is therefore capable of eliminating the oily deposits on the hair, while the head connects them to the water in order to wash them away. Several of these oily down payments are due to sebum, a natural material created by a gland at the root of the hair that keeps it lubricated however likewise makes hair look greasy as it builds up.

"Hotter water [] lowers the surface stress in between the oils and the water, so more will possibly liquify a little bit if you scrub truly hard. It's a little bit like an oily plate," claimed science teacher and aesthetic chemist Michelle Wong, that was not associated with the paper. A lot like with oil on a plate, the outcome of simply hot water is never best.


Nonetheless, other down payments from styling items or external contamination (which water or vinegar are no better at eliminating) would certainly still develop and get entraped in the sebum. This might irritate the scalp and perhaps hinder hair growth. Still, not all surfactants are sulfate-based, so does it make feeling to select sulfate-free hair shampoos? "People have actually vilified sulfate surfactants [] since sulfates are harsher on the skin than other surfactant options, yet they are the best at cleansing, they are a knockout post the cheapest, they're the most readily available, one of the most quickly made," claimed the study's co-author, Courtney Thompson, researcher at the College of Sheffield.


"You can develop a sulfate-containing hair shampoo to in fact be gentler than a non-sulfate-containing shampoo," Wong verified. In truth, Wong believes that a possible aspect behind the movement towards avoiding items in general may come from applications which scan listings of active ingredients and highlight allegedly damaging ones. "Those applications are really one-dimensional: if it remains in there, it misbehaves; if it's not in there, it's great.


And yet, an increasing number of brand names are relocating away from sulfates and offering alternative solutions, probably because "they've surrendered on trying to persuade customers," she claimed. Next on shampoo manufacturers' to-do checklist is to come to be a lot more environmentally lasting. There are 2 targets to decrease: influence of the production and transport processes and damage to the waste water system.

Other research study by Thompson in partnership with Unilever revealed that an eco-friendly active ingredient which was previously located not to function well could be effective in a different solution. Eco-friendly ingredients ought to constantly be favored, because non-biodegradable ones end up creating microplastics when they drop the drainpipe. That is why fine-grained research study is needed in order to recognize exactly how ideal to create hair shampoo to accomplish the desired results at the least environmental and economic cost.
